CSS中的外邊距是一種非常重要的屬性,它可以決定元素與其他元素之間的距離。在頁面布局中,外邊距一般用來控制元素與頁面邊緣、其他元素的距離。
在CSS中,設置外邊距可以使用margin屬性。margin屬性可以有4個值,分別對應元素的上、右、下、左四個方向的外邊距,如下所示:
p { margin: 上外邊距 右外邊距 下外邊距 左外邊距; }上外邊距和下外邊距可以使用以下單位: - px:像素; - em:相對于元素字體大小的單位; - %:相對于元素父元素寬度的百分比。 左外邊距和右外邊距可以使用上述單位,也可以使用以下單位: - auto:自動計算; - inherit:繼承父元素外邊距。 以下是一些示例代碼,展示如何設置外邊距:
p { margin: 10px; /* 上下左右外邊距都為10像素 */ } p { margin: 10px 20px; /* 上下外邊距為10像素,左右外邊距為20像素 */ } p { margin: 10px 20px 30px; /* 上外邊距為10像素,左右外邊距為20像素,下外邊距為30像素 */ } p { margin: 10px 20px 30px 40px; /* 上外邊距為10像素,右外邊距為20像素,下外邊距為30像素,左外邊距為40像素 */ } p { margin-top: 10px; margin-right: 20px; margin-bottom: 30px; margin-left: 40px; }總之,外邊距是CSS布局中非常重要的一個屬性,通過控制元素之間的距離,可以實現各種各樣的頁面布局效果。
上一篇css如何設置超出換行
下一篇ajax如何提交文件類型